Fans will get to watch fresh new episodes for "Rick and Morty" season 3 as it was announced that news writers hopped on board to join their creative team. Dan Harmon highlighted that the additional show runners will bring gender balance to the show.

"We hired a bunch of new writers," Dan Harmon told Den of Geek in an exclusive interview. "There was a craving for a gender balance in the writers' room that we had never had, but I'm also very proud of the fact that we didn't compromise ourselves following that craving. We just looked harder and I don't know if it was coincidence or because the show was popping up on the radar of a lot of great female writers noticing, 'Well, they don't have any women writers in there. I'm gonna submit something.' It was probably a combination of all those factors."
